摘要
This paper proposes a modular capsule robot. It can move actively. The main robot is responsible for collecting images to determine the location of the lesion, and the auxiliary robot is used to release medicine to the location of the lesion. Their 3D models were constructed by SolidWorks and printed by 3D printers. In addition, it also carefully presents the robot's drive system, motion control theory, and the principle of drug delivery. In the magnetic field generated by the three-axis Helmholtz coil, the robot's motion characteristics are tested, and the relationship curve between the robot's speed and the current frequency is simulated. The modular experiment of two robots also has been verified many times.
